当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储服务器和数据库的区别和联系,深入解析,对象存储服务器与数据库的异同及融合趋势

对象存储服务器和数据库的区别和联系,深入解析,对象存储服务器与数据库的异同及融合趋势

对象存储服务器与数据库在存储方式、数据结构、操作方式等方面存在显著差异,但都用于数据存储。随着技术的发展,两者正逐渐融合,如分布式存储系统将对象存储与数据库技术相结合。...

对象存储服务器与数据库在存储方式、数据结构、操作方式等方面存在显著差异,但都用于数据存储。随着技术的发展,两者正逐渐融合,如分布式存储系统将对象存储与数据库技术相结合。融合趋势将进一步加强,以满足大数据时代对高效、可靠存储的需求。

随着互联网技术的飞速发展,数据已成为企业核心竞争力的重要组成部分,对象存储服务器和数据库作为存储数据的重要工具,在数据管理、数据分析和数据挖掘等方面发挥着重要作用,本文将从对象存储服务器和数据库的区别、联系以及融合趋势等方面进行深入探讨。

对象存储服务器与数据库的区别

1、存储方式

对象存储服务器以对象为单位存储数据,每个对象包含数据本身、元数据和访问控制信息,数据库以记录为单位存储数据,记录通常由多个字段组成。

2、数据结构

对象存储服务器采用非关系型数据结构,支持海量、非结构化和半结构化数据的存储,数据库采用关系型数据结构,通过表、视图、索引等手段实现数据的组织和管理。

对象存储服务器和数据库的区别和联系,深入解析,对象存储服务器与数据库的异同及融合趋势

3、扩展性

对象存储服务器具有极高的扩展性,可以通过横向扩展(增加存储节点)和纵向扩展(提升存储节点性能)来提高存储能力,数据库的扩展性相对较低,主要依靠垂直扩展(提升服务器性能)来实现。

4、性能

对象存储服务器在读取大量数据时具有较高性能,但写入性能相对较低,数据库在读写操作上均具有较高的性能,但面对海量数据时性能可能受到限制。

5、安全性

对象存储服务器通过访问控制列表(ACL)和共享密钥等方式实现数据安全,数据库采用用户权限、角色和审计等手段保障数据安全。

6、数据管理

对象存储服务器通过元数据实现数据的组织和管理,如桶(Bucket)、对象(Object)等,数据库通过表、视图、索引等手段实现数据的组织和管理。

对象存储服务器和数据库的区别和联系,深入解析,对象存储服务器与数据库的异同及融合趋势

对象存储服务器与数据库的联系

1、数据交互

对象存储服务器和数据库可以通过API接口进行数据交互,实现数据共享和协同处理。

2、融合应用

随着大数据、云计算等技术的发展,对象存储服务器和数据库在融合应用方面具有广阔前景,将对象存储服务器作为数据湖,数据库作为数据处理平台,实现数据的高效存储、管理和分析。

3、数据迁移

企业可以根据实际需求,将数据从对象存储服务器迁移到数据库,或将数据从数据库迁移到对象存储服务器。

融合趋势

1、数据湖与数据库融合

随着大数据时代的到来,数据湖(Data Lake)作为一种新型的数据存储方式,逐渐受到关注,数据湖与数据库的融合,可以实现海量数据的存储、处理和分析。

对象存储服务器和数据库的区别和联系,深入解析,对象存储服务器与数据库的异同及融合趋势

2、NoSQL与SQL融合

NoSQL数据库和SQL数据库在性能、扩展性等方面具有各自的优势,两者将逐步融合,实现优势互补。

3、分布式存储与数据库融合

分布式存储系统具有高可用性、高扩展性等特点,与数据库的融合将进一步提高数据存储和处理能力。

对象存储服务器和数据库在存储方式、数据结构、扩展性、性能、安全性和数据管理等方面存在差异,随着技术的不断发展,两者在融合趋势下将发挥更大的作用,企业应根据自身需求,选择合适的数据存储和数据库解决方案,以实现数据的高效管理、分析和挖掘。

黑狐家游戏

发表评论

最新文章